A wide range of volunteers who serve in the Roman Catholic Diocese of Saskatoon — serving in ministry and outreach, on committees and commissions, in hospitals and in the prison, with youth and with families, in administration, finance, evangelization, and more — were honoured and recognized this evening at a volunteer appreciation event held June 7, 2023 at the Cathedral of the Holy Family in Saskatoon.“On behalf of the diocese, I say thank you, thank you, thank you, so much,” said Bishop Mark Hagemoen.Concluding the evening, the bishop cited 1Corinthians 12:4-7: “There are a variety of gifts, but the same Spirit, a variety of services but the same Lord, varieties of activities but the same God who activates all of them and everyone…to each is given the Spirit for the common good and the blessing of God’s people.”
